Overview
- The series delivered an unannounced Juliette Lewis cameo in Episode 3, which was first reported in coverage published Friday.
- Creator Nick Antosca told USA TODAY that Lewis is playing an entirely new character in the reboot and not reprising her 1991 role.
- Critics and recaps say the cameo deliberately links the new show to the 1991 Scorsese film while serving a plot function that changes what the season is centered on.
- Cast interviews and early coverage stress the series uses modern digital and social media fears to heighten parental anxiety and expand the story across ten episodes.
- Cape Fear is a weekly Apple TV+ limited series created by Nick Antosca with Martin Scorsese and Steven Spielberg as executive producers, and Lewis’s return adds a nostalgic connection to the franchise’s 1991 history.
